Kevin M Cockroft, MD - Medicare Neurosurgery in Hershey, PA

Kevin M Cockroft, MD is a medicare enrolled "Neurological Surgery" physician in Hershey, Pennsylvania. He went to Js Weill Medical College, Cornell University and graduated in 1991 and has 33 years of diverse experience with area of expertise as Neurosurgery. He is a member of the group practice The Milton S Hershey Medical Center Physicians Group and his current practice location is 30 Hope Dr Ste 1200, Hershey, Pennsylvania. You can reach out to his office (for appointments etc.) via phone at (717) 531-3828.

Kevin M Cockroft is licensed to practice in Pennsylvania (license number MD066405L) and he also participates in the medicare program. He accepts medicare assignments (which means he accepts the Medicare-approved amount; you will not be billed for any more than the Medicare deductible and coinsurance) and his NPI Number is 1356393870.

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Kevin M Cockroft allows following entities to bill medicare on his behalf.

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Kevin M Cockroft is enrolled with medicare and thus, if eligible, can pr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.
